Polly Ann DeVasher

Birth21 August 1833 - Middletown (Jefferson County), Jefferson County, Kentucky, USA
Death14 May 1921 - Omaha, Douglas County, Nebraska, USA
MotherNot Available
FatherNot Available

Born in Middletown (Jefferson County), Jefferson County, Kentucky, USA on 21 August 1833. Polly Ann DeVasher married James William DeVasher and had 6 children. He passed away on 14 May 1921 in Omaha, Douglas County, Nebraska, USA.
